[01] MINISTER OF FINANCE - UNIONS - COLA
Finance Minister Kikis Kazamias and the main trade unions - PEO, SEK
and PASIDY - have agreed on a freeze on the adjustment in the cost of
living allowance (CoLA) for employees in the public and the broader
public sector.
They have also agreed that CoLA should continue to be paid to workers
in the private sector.
During todays meeting at the Ministry of Finance, Kazamias said the
social partners and the government agreed that the adjustments on the
CoLA will freeze until the end of 2013 in the public sector but will
continue to be paid, as normal, to workers in the private sector.
He said that he is preparing the proposal on the second package of
austerity measures, set to be tabled to the House on Thursday.
Kazamias said the government will put forward proposals to help reduce
the public deficit through measures which would affect the wealth.
